I agree that 20% looks damn good. It is light enough to see out fine, but dark enough that it really makes a big difference in appearance. I have 5% on a single cab ranger, and it can get hard to see out of at night, but you definitely can't see inside haha. If I had it to do over, I would stick with 20%
